Shirafura is a 30-meter high and 500-meters long white cliff on the Takinose Coast in Otobe. Upon leaving the Takinose Coast parking lot, the first thing you will see is a cliff called “Kuguri Iwa,” a hole in the sea that was excavated 400 years ago to open a road. From there, walk another 600-meters to Shirafura. The white cliffs are said to have been formed when pumice tuff erupted from a volcano about 5 million years ago, which created deposits that later jutted up mysteriously.
